Across TCGA patient cohorts, FABP7P1 RNA expression is significantly associated with the protein abundance of many other proteins, with 17,302 significant associations in total. GBM sh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ible FABP7P1-associated proteins across cancer lineages are SORBS3, AKT3, and MSRB3. Each is linked with FABP7P1 in more than 6 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both FABP7P1-to-partner and partner-to-FABP7P1 results are reported.
